SN2011bl • LOSS/KAIT April 5.41 • Ibc mag = 16.9 • UGC 8554 z = 0.025 • SNF 9 spectra 4.12 to 5.30 • ESO/TNG 4.10 to 12.23 • Joseph Brimacombe • Proposal Submitted
SNID Supernova Identification Estimate type , redshift and phase for a given SN spectrum . Reads in a data file : wavelength vs flux Compares to 1515 spectra from 111 objects Various options available for setting parameters Blondin and Tonry 2007
GEneric CLAssification Tool Padova Observatory Harutyunyan et al. 2005
SNF Supernova Factory • Training Sample Data • 62 Type Ia • 0.007 < z < 0.11 • -12.3 < day < +55.3 • 3200-5100 , 5000-9700 blue red • Restframe spectra : Dereddened, deredshifted, resampled to B, merged.
Hsiao SNIa Template E.Y.Hsiao 2007 • 106 spectra , -20 to +85 days • SNLS,ESSENCE, SUSPECT • More spectra around zero day for SNF
